The Joint Labour Movement leadership in Osun State has rejected the staff audit suggested by the state government, calling for a proper briefing on the exercise.
This position of the labor leaders had come after forms had been circulating among workers by a consulting firm hired by the state government for counting the number of workers on its payroll.
Meanwhile, the leadership of the Joint Labour Movement, including the Nigeria Labour Congress and the Trade Union Congress in the state, have announced that they were rejecting the exercise due to the hardship experienced by their workers and pensioners in the past after an audit like that was made.
